  • I use my MacBook Air as a desktop computer. Should I leave the charger plugged all the time or should I drain the battery and then recharge? What is the best for the battery?

    I use my MacBook Air as a desktop computer. Should I leave the charger plugged all the time or should I drain the battery and then recharge? What is the best for the battery?

    Keep the computer plugged in whenever possible.

    If you keep the computer always connected, make sure that at least twice a month

    Run it on battery until battery charge level falls to about 40-50%.

    Please don't completely discharge the battery. Discharge the battery completely will reduce wear and tear on the battery.

    For more information:

    Section: To optimize the battery life

    http://support.Apple.com/en-us/HT204054

    Citing at the bottom of the linked article.

    "The question is often asked:" should I disconnect my laptop from the mains when not in service? Under normal circumstances it should not be necessary because as soon as the lithium-ion battery is full, a properly functioning charger will stop the load and load the pad will only engage when the battery voltage drops to a low level. Most of the users do not remove AC power, and this practice is safe. »

    Hello

    The laptop is supported by a battery of 6 cells 4400mAh
    It is a common battery that is built in series of laptops different, and it should be possible to extend the battery up to 3,5-4 hours work.

    But be aware that the battery working time depends on notebook use.

    Various factors may change the time of working of dough: brightness of the display, for example, use of CD/DVD and HARD disk drive, the CPU and cooling performance module all of these parts would drain the battery more slowly or faster depending on the settings.

    Working with the applications Office could slower battery as a game or watch movies on DVD.

    The formula is: t = Q / I
    t = time
    Q = electric charge (Ah)
    I have = amperage (A)

    So if you want to use Notepad for example 4 hours then all laptop computer s devices should not use more than 1000mA - 1100mA in an hour.
